Slate roof le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ing leaks that compromise the integrity of slate roofing systems. These services typically involve thorough inspections to locate the source of leaks, which can be caused by cracked, broken, or missing slate tiles, as well as issues with flashing or underlying roofing materials. Once the problem areas are identified, local contractors may perform repairs such as replacing damaged slate tiles, sealing gaps, or installing new flashing to prevent water intrusion. The goal is to restore the roof’s watertight condition while maintaining the aesthetic appeal of the slate surface.

Leaking slate roofs can lead to a range of problems if not addressed promptly. Water infiltration can cause damage to the underlying roof deck, insulation, and interior ceilings, resulting in m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ration. In addition, persistent leaks may lead to increased energy costs due to compromised insulation and can diminish the overall value of a property. Repairing leaks early helps prevent these costly issues, protecting both the property’s structural integrity and its interior spaces.

Material Replacement - Replacing damaged slate tiles typically costs between $600 and $1,200 per square, depending on tile quality and size. The total expense varies based on the extent of the damage and the number of tiles affected.

Leak Repair - Fixing leaks in slate roofs can range from $300 to $1,000 for localized repairs. Larger or more complex leaks may increase costs, especially if underlying structural issues are involved.

Flashing and Sealant - Installing or repairing flashing and sealants around roof penetrations usually costs between $200 and $500. Proper sealing helps prevent water intrusion and extends roof lifespan.

Inspection and Maintenance - Routine inspections and minor repairs generally fall within a $150 to $400 range. Regular maintenance can help identify issues early and reduce overall repair cost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ew around the roof area.

How do professionals typically repair slate roof leaks? Repair methods often involve replacing damaged or missing slate tiles, sealing small cracks, and ensuring proper flashing around roof penetrations.

Can a roof leak be fixed without replacing the entire slate roof? Yes, many leaks can be addressed through targeted repairs such as replacing individual tiles or sealing specific areas, avoiding a full roof replacement.
